生物活性

TKP-5 is a PROTAC protein degrader targeting BRD4. TKP-5 can binds to BRD2, BRD3, BRD4 and BRDT, with Ka values of 150 nM, 100 nM and 150 nM for the first three proteins respectively. TKP-5 inhibits the production of thymic stromal lymphopoietin and suppresses the expression of IL-33 mRNA. TKP-5 is applicable to studies related to tape-stripping induced skin injury[1]. (Pink: Epigenetic Reader Domain ligand (HY-182371); Blue: Cereblon ligand (HY-10984); Black: linker).

体外研究
(In Vitro)

TKP-5 (0.1-10 μM; 2-24 h) 可强效降解 KCMH-1 细胞中的 BRD4,其 DC50 为 16.78 nM;在浓度低至 0.1 μM 时即可抑制 KCMH-1 细胞中 TSLP 的产生;在 1 μM 浓度下可选择性结合 BRD2、BRD3、BRD4 及 BRDT 的 BD1 结构域;并通过其三唑基团与 BRD4 的 Trp81 之间的相互作用,与 CRBN 和 BRD4-BD1 形成稳定的三元复合物[1]
TKP-5 (处理 5 小时) 可在低于 100 nM 的浓度下诱导 KCMH-1 细胞中 BRD2、BRD3 和 BRD4 的降解[1]

体内研究
(In Vivo)

TKP-5 (1% (w/w);局部给药;单次给药;6 小时) 可完全抑制 8 周龄雄性 ICR 小鼠中由胶带剥离诱导的皮肤损伤相关 IL-33 mRNA 表达[1]

Animal Model: ICR (male, 8 weeks old, skin barrier disruption model via 10x tape-stripping)[1]
Dosage: 1% (w/w) (80 mg total)
Administration: topical; single application; 6 hours
Result: Completely suppressed skin injury-induced IL-33 mRNA expression, with levels reduced to near baseline values and significantly lower than both vehicle control and 1.2% TK-351 ointment groups.
